Typical features of cerebellar ataxic gait

Summary
Patients with cerebellar disease (CD) exhibit reduced step frequency and increased balance adjustments during gait. Quantitative analysis using a tandem gait paradigm reveals typical cerebellar ataxia features, highlighting its diagnostic sensitivity.
Area of Science:
- Neurology
- Biomechanics
- Gait Analysis
Background:
- Gait disturbance is a significant disabling symptom in cerebellar disease (CD).
- Quantitative studies on cerebellar gait are limited.
Purpose of the Study:
- Characterize clinical features of cerebellar gait.
- Quantitatively analyze gait ataxia in CD patients.
Main Methods:
- Compared 12 CD patients with 12 age-matched controls.
- Used a 3D motion system for treadmill gait analysis.
- Employed a tandem gait paradigm to quantify ataxia.
Main Results:
- CD patients showed reduced step frequency, prolonged stance, and increased double limb support.
- Gait measurements in CD were highly variable.
- Increased step width and foot rotation angles indicated a need for stability.
- Tandem gait revealed dysmetria, hypometria, hypermetria, and improper foot placement timing.
Conclusions:
- Cerebellar gait features reduced cadence, increased balance-related variables, and variable joint motion.
- The tandem gait paradigm is a sensitive clinical test for accentuating gait ataxia features.
